Job Description: Minimum Qualifications: Bachelor's Degree in human services field required. Knowledge of community resources or ability to learn quickly. Good organizational, time management, writing and verbal skills; proficient in MS Outlook, Word and Excel. One year experience working with adult mental health required. Committed to working with adults with both mental illness and substance use disorder. Ability to work well with community partners. Florida Driver license in good standing; able to meet Centerstone’s insurance company standards. Preferred Qualifications: Bilingual English/Spanish. Experience with Co-occurring services preferred. Enthusiastic about facilitating groups that develop rehabilitation, recovery, life and employability skills. Experience working with persons from diverse backgrounds or persons with barriers to employment. Special Skills, Knowledge and Abilities: Knowledge of community resources, in particular Social Security and Department of Children and Families, for clients/patients with mental illness, addiction or co-occurring disorders. Highly motivated, self-directed, and excellent team building skills. High level of attention to detail; accuracy and timeliness in all transactional activities. Knowledge of community services. Experience in a mental health setting preferred. Strong communication, teaming and time management skills necessary. Ability to work well with community partners. Ability to analyze extensive data and create written reports with accuracy and brevity. Essential Functions/Job Duties: Assume primary responsibility for assessing client and family strengths, challenges and needs of an assigned group of clients. In conjunction with the team, responsible for developing, writing, implementing, evaluating and revising overall treatment goals and plans per on-going assessment of needs and input from the client and family. Conduct on-going assessment of behavior, mental status, signs and symptoms of mental health disorder, physical and dental health, substance use, and educational, social, legal, financial, housing, developmental and family functioning. Refers, advocates and links client and family for additional services as identified. Act as liaison and collaborates with community agencies/institutions and support systems to maintain coordination of the treatment process. Provides supportive and educational counseling services (individual, family and group) to develop daily living and coping skills. Perform classroom activities, including leading small groups, and teaching specific components of the FDIC Money Smart financial education program. Assist clients with developing natural support systems. Provide on-call crisis intervention services during nighttime and weekend hours as assigned. Provide transportation, respite and tutoring services as assigned. Participates in treatment team meetings Maintains client’s chart updated and all documentation entered within established timeframe. Completes all required agency and department trainings. Ability to interpret Federal, State, and local laws, regulations, and administrative codes on public benefits. Complete interviews with individuals to gather information to complete SOAR applications. Gather medical records and other information to complete SOAR applications. Write SOAR Medical Summary Reports for individual applications. Accompany individuals to appointments at the Social Security Administration. Assists clients in obtaining individualized information about how entitlements (e.g., SSI, SSDI, Medicaid, etc.) will be affected by employment so clients can make decisions about employment opportunities. Refers clients to benefits counseling, as needed. Work Environment/Physical Demands: Work in the field in different environments and involved with clients, residents, family members, personnel, visitors, government agencies/personnel, etc., in a behavioral health setting. If employed in hospitals, case managers work in clean, well-lit establishments, but they can be exposed to various health conditions. Sits, stands, bends, lifts and moves intermittently during work hours. Is subject to frequent interruptions. The noise level in the work environment is usually moderate to occasionally loud. Position Type, Expected Hours of Work and Travel: This is a full-time position, and the expected work hours are 40 hours per week, Monday - Friday - 8:30-5:00. Early mornings, evenings and weekend might be required to meet need of client. Weekend on call may be required. Travel is required.
